Table 3.
Host biological pathways targeted by helminth miRNAs according to predictions.
| Pathways | Helminth-host association |
|---|---|
| Common to all helminth-host associations | |
| T cell receptor signaling, Ras signaling, Rap1 signaling, FoxO signaling, ErbB signaling | Asu/Ssc, Hco/Oar, Hpo/Mmu, Tmu/Mmu, Cel/Mmu, Cel/Ssc, Cel/Oar |
| Other pathways of interest in associations involving parasitic species | |
| Mucin type O-glycan biosynthesis | Asu/Ssc |
| Notch signaling pathway | Asu/Ssc, Hpo/Mmu |
| TGF-beta signaling pathway | Hco/Oar, Tmu/Mmu, Hpo/Tmu |
| mTOR signaling pathway | Asu/Ssc, Hco/Oar, Tmu/Mmu, Hpo/Mmu |
| Th17 cell differentiation | Asu/Ssc |
| Pathways of interest targeted by species-specific miRNA seeds | |
| AGE-RAGE signaling pathway | Asu/Ssc, Hco/Oar, Hpo/Tmu |
Selected significantly enriched host pathways are listed, according to adjusted p-value (p < 0.05), focusing on elements of the host immune system. Asu, A. suum; Hco, H. contortus; Hpo, H. polygyrus; Tmu, T. muris; Cel, C. elegans; Ssc, S. scrofa; Oar, O. aries; Mmu, M. musculus.
